SPICY SHRIMP LETTUCE WRAPS

Serves 4 | Prep Time | Cook Time 4-6

Why I Love This Recipe

This is a family favorite healthy snack created by one of our amazing Skinny Body Care Distributors.


Ingredients You'll Need

1 lb of good size shrimp peeled and de-veined
6 oz Greek Yogurt
1/4 cup chopped cilantro
1 - 2 tablespoons fresh lime juice
1/4 to 1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per or to taste
5 cups (approximately) of thinly sliced cabbage
Boston or Bibb lettuce for the wraps (these have the nicest cups for filling) or lettuce of your choice
4 teaspoon coconut oil
salt and pepper to taste


Directions

1.Mix yogurt, cilantro, cayenne, lime juice and salt in a bowl and set aside.


2.Heat 2 teaspoons of coconut oil in a medium non-stick skillet and add cabbage. Cook for about four minutes or until the cabbage is barely wilted. Season with salt and pepper and set aside.


3.Cut shrimp into bite size pieces (about 3 cuts per shrimp). Saute in 2 teaspoons of coconut oil and season with salt, pepper and a dash of cayenne pepper over medium heat just until done. This only takes a few minutes, so do not take your eyes away.


4.Build your lettuce wrap. First place some of the sauce, then a scoop of cabbage, then the shrimp and top with the cilantro sauce. Roll up and enjoy!
